PAC Strapping Products Highlights its High Performance Polyester Strapping

Press release from the issuing company

Superior performance and lower cost compared to steel and other traditional strapping options

Exton, PA – PAC Strapping Products, a leader in the strapping and packaging industry, highlights its High Performance Polyester Strapping, a consistent, high-quality product for the toughest strapping applications. PAC High Performance Polyester Strapping combines the strength of steel strapping with the safety and economy of plastic to maximize performance, resulting in a more secure load at a lower cost.

Designed to meet the rigorous demands of heavy-duty bundling, palletizing, and load security, PAC's High Performance Polyester (PET) Strapping promises superior performance compared to steel and other traditional strapping options. Engineered with advanced materials and through state-of-the-art manufacturing processes, this robust, cost-effective strapping solution ensures secure and reliable load containment.

One of the key benefits of PAC High Performance Polyester is elongation recovery. Applied properly, PAC High Performance Polyester Strapping will stretch under tension. However, most of the elongation is recovered after the initial application. The result is a strap that stays tight even if the load shrinks or settles during transit. Additionally, the PET material maintains high retained tension, staying tighter than steel and polypropylene. Ultimately, this results in shipments that remain secure even when they undergo significant movement during transit.

PAC High Performance Polyester is environmentally friendly due to its high recycled content and ease of recyclability. PAC Strapping offers solutions for their customers and municipalities to support recycling strap, helping to close the loop. Moreover, it is almost impervious to weather conditions, unlike steel, which rusts and is affected by the elements.

Safety is another critical benefit: the danger from strap recoil injuries is significantly reduced, there are no sharp edges with PAC High Performance Polyester which eliminates operator lacerations and PAC High Performance Polyester coils weigh about half as much as steel coils, enhancing lifting ergonomics and reducing potential injuries.

Cost savings can also be substantial, with a potential of 25-50% over steel strapping. In addition, there are potential opportunities for labor cost reductions when applying PAC High Performance Polyester over steel.
